2024年,日本壓力感測器市場規模達11億美元。展望未來, IMARC Group預計到2033年,該市場規模將達到25億美元,2025-2033年期間的複合年成長率(CAGR)為8.4%。物聯網(IoT)、穿戴式裝置和智慧家庭自動化系統等新興技術的日益普及,增強了對壓力感測器的需求,以實現更精確、更數據驅動的控制,從而推動了市場的發展。
壓力感測器是一種專用於測量和檢測特定環境或系統內壓力變化的設備。它透過將施加的壓力轉換為電訊號來工作,然後電訊號可以被解讀並用於各種用途。壓力感測器廣泛應用於汽車、航太、醫療和工業等產業。這些感測器可分為多種類型,例如壓電式、電容式和電阻式感測器,每種感測器都有其獨特的壓力檢測機制。壓電式感測器響應壓力變化產生電壓,電容式感測器依賴電容的變化,而電阻式感測器在受到壓力時會改變其電阻。壓力感測器在製程監控、確保安全和提高效率方面發揮著至關重要的作用。它們廣泛應用於輪胎壓力監測系統、醫療設備、暖通空調系統和工業自動化等應用。從壓力感測器收集的資料有助於維持最佳狀態,防止設備故障,並提高整體系統性能,使其成為現代技術和工程的重要組成部分。

Japan pressure sensor market size reached USD 1.1 Billion in 2024. Looking forward, IMARC Group expects the market to reach USD 2.5 Billion by 2033, exhibiting a growth rate (CAGR) of 8.4% during 2025-2033. The increasing utilization of emerging technologies like the Internet of Things (IoT), wearable devices, and smart home automation systems that enhances the demand for pressure sensors to enable more precise and data-driven control, is driving the market.
A pressure sensor is a specialized device designed to measure and detect changes in pressure within a given environment or system. It operates by converting the applied pressure into an electrical signal, which can then be interpreted and utilized for various purposes. Pressure sensors find wide-ranging applications across industries, including automotive, aerospace, medical, and industrial sectors. These sensors can be categorized into various types, such as piezoelectric, capacitive, and resistive sensors, each with their unique mechanism for pressure detection. Piezoelectric sensors generate voltage in response to pressure changes, while capacitive sensors rely on changes in capacitance, and resistive sensors alter their electrical resistance when subjected to pressure. Pressure sensors play a crucial role in monitoring and controlling processes, ensuring safety, and enhancing efficiency. They are used in applications like tire pressure monitoring systems, medical devices, HVAC systems, and industrial automation. The data collected from pressure sensors helps maintain optimal conditions, prevent equipment failures, and improve overall system performance, making them essential components in modern technology and engineering.
